  1. Click on "My Freight" on the left of your EIS screen and press the button "+Create new freight"



  2. Enter the "Freight requisitioner" and the "Freight information" as the first steps of this module.



  3. Go "to collect freight" and follow the sections:



    add your articles in section "Create item" (1)



    and put these directly into "Move here" section area (3) if your articles do not need to be packed



    or use "Put article in box" section area (2) and then put the created and filled packings down to the "Move here" section area (3).



  4. Click "Submit freight"



    Additional information
  5. Sometimes it might be helpful to have someone available as your administrative substitute on a particular freight. You can add the email-address of this person in the "Freight requisitioner" area.



  6. You have taken part in a former expedition? All expeditions starting from PS121 onwards keep your submitted freight data!
    Maybe you can re-use your freight information you submitted earlier - check this in "Collect freight"!

Additional information: "Special freight"

"Special freight" named here relates to: refrigerated cargo, biological samples or dangerous goods
refrigerated cargo/biological samples

If you add "refrigerated cargo" to your freight, please add the information of the temparature to the details of the normal freight details.

If you add "biological samples" to your freight, please add the information of the taxom and while you pull this freight item down to section area (3), you need to enter the sample origin. Please take care of the value of your samples. Your samples should not show more value than just some EURO-Cents, as the whole value of the ship's samples load should not exceed more than EUR 45,-!

The information on items and packaging is more complex in connection with dangerous goods than for normal freight. Please fill in all the information correctly in sections areas (1) and (2) before pulling and submitting your freight items in section area (3). Please make sure that all required information is be available to you before you start entering your data.

Own packing lists used?
If you have used your own packing lists - please upload the dangerous goods packing list afterwards. Please use the version provided by AWI logistics on the website.
If you are not offered the IMO template in EIS because you use your own packing lists and thus exclude article creation in section area (1), please download the instructions on how to fill in an IMO correctly from the AWI website.
